Police: Car Break-In Reported in Chestnut Hill

The following information is provided by the Philadelphia Police Department.

Police responded to a car break in Chestnut Hill, according to a release from the Philadelphia Police Department.

According to reports, an area resident reported to police that, after parking their car near 10 Bethlehem Pike in Chestnut Hill, they returned to their car and found the passenger-side window had been broken.

The resident reported reported that $60 in cash, as well a credit card and drivers license, was taken from the car.

Police advise that residents not keep valuables in their cars.
